GC-TBZ48L. Description. The GC-TBZ48 Z-Wave Plus Thermostat is a programmable, Z-Wave communicating thermostat. It can be powered using 24VAC, or using four (4) AA batteries. Using Z-Wave technology, end users have the ability to use most compatible Z-Wave hubs/controllers to operate and animate the thermostat, …Z-Wave is a wireless communication protocol that allows smart home devices to talk to each other, just like Wi-Fi (actually, Wi-Fi is a collection of protocols). Z-Wave operates on a low-energy radio wave frequency, around 908.42 MHz in the US, and can connect up to 232 devices within your home. Developed by Danish company Zensys in 2001, Z-Wave is a wireless networking protocol primarily designed for use in home automation. Z-Wave was bought by Sigma Designs in 2009, which then sold the technology to Silicon Labs for $240 million earlier in 2018. However, with the right guidance, configuring your Canon printer c...Figure 3 - Z-Wave devices before Inclusion in to a network. Depending on which of the controllers is used to configure the Z-Wave network, the network Home ID in this example will be either #0x00001111 or #0x00002222. Both controllers have the same Node ID #0x01 and at this stage the slave devices do not have any Node ID assigned.Having trouble with your Z-Wave network (slow devices, devices not responding, difficulty adding/including devices, etc.)? The Z-WAVE EXPERT USER INTERFACE is designed for installers, technically savvy people, and other users that know how to build and maintain a Z-Wave-based wireless network. Hence, it uses some Z-Wave specific-language and offers detailed insight into the work and data structure of the Z-Wave network.
